Comprehensive Guide to Understanding Expansion Slots Expansion slots are essential parts of the motherboard of a computer, made to support extra hardware that boosts the system's performance. These slots offer a path for different expansion cards, such as network cards, sound cards, graphics cards, and more. Expansion slots are essential for modifying and enhancing a computer's performance to suit particular requirements, as they enable users to add or upgrade components. These slots are an essential component of contemporary computing because they allow users to customize their systems for specific tasks like gaming, graphic design, data processing, or other specialized applications.

By connecting to the motherboard's circuitry when an expansion card is inserted into a slot, data can move between the card and the CPU or other parts. The size, pin arrangement, and data transfer capacities of each kind of expansion slot are unique. To enable high-speed communication between the installed card and the motherboard, for example, PCIe slots make use of a number of lanes. The potential bandwidth for data transfer increases with the number of lanes in a slot; this is especially crucial for high-performance applications like gaming and video editing.

Understanding Expansion Slots: The Key to Upgrading Your PC
This flexibility is crucial in an ever evolving technological environment where performance and user experience can be greatly impacted by keeping up with the latest developments. On motherboards, expansion slots come in a variety of forms, each intended for a particular function and hardware compatibility. Peripheral Component Interconnect (PCI), PCI Express (PCIe), Accelerated Graphics Port (AGP), and older standards like Industry Standard Architecture (ISA) are the most popular types. Due to PCIe's greater speed and efficiency, PCI slots—which were once widely used for a variety of peripherals—have mostly been superseded by PCI.
In the early days of personal computing, users looked for ways to improve their machines' functionality without having to replace the entire system. This is when the concept of expansion slots originated. These slots now have faster data transfer rates and better compatibility with a wider range of hardware thanks to significant design and technological advancements over time. Today, expansion slots are more than just a way to add extra features; they're a symbol of the modularity of computing, enabling users to gradually upgrade their systems as technology develops.

PCIe slots are available in a variety of configurations, including x1, x4, x8, & x16, which represent the number of data transfer lanes that are available. Because of its adaptability, users can select the right slot for their expansion cards according to their performance needs. AGP offered a dedicated connection that enhanced performance for 3D rendering tasks and was created especially for graphics cards. But as technology developed & the need for more bandwidth grew, AGP was gradually replaced by PCIe, which provides much faster data transfer speeds and more flexibility.
